Mackintosh
Not to be confused with a Macintosh computer, a Mackintosh is a form of waterproof raincoat, first sold in 1824, made out of rubberized fabric. It is named after its Scottish inventor Charles Macintosh, though a letter k is commonly added. In the present day, the Mackintosh style of coat has become generic, but a genuine Mackintosh coat should be made from rubberized or rubber laminated material.
